Best source photos

Best source photos for natural family photo ideas

Creative family photo ideas work better when the source photos are readable. The model has less to guess, which usually gives you a more believable result.

Use source photos with visible faces so the family remains recognizable in the final result.

Try to keep the lighting similar across photos when possible, because big lighting differences make the result work harder.

Avoid heavily blurry photos. A family photo idea works better when the model can read the eyes, hair, and overall pose.

Do not mix too many conflicting angles if you can help it. A front-facing photo and a side profile are harder to combine naturally.

Fewer good photos often beat many weak photos, because there are fewer contradictions for the model to solve.

When results may look unnatural and why

Blurry faces, extreme angle differences, and harsh shadows force the model to guess. The more it has to guess, the more the final picture can drift away from the idea you had in mind.

Idea examples

Family photo idea examples you can adapt

The strongest family photo ideas are short, specific, and easy to read. Say what you want, name the mood, and keep one clear style direction.

Weak direction
Make this family picture look better.
Better direction
Create a cozy indoor family photo idea with soft window light, relaxed smiles, and a natural living-room feel.
Cozy indoor idea
Create a cozy indoor family photo idea with soft window light, relaxed smiles, and a natural living-room feel.
Golden hour idea
Create a golden-hour family photo idea outdoors, keep the scene warm, and make the composition feel easy and believable.
Pets included idea
Create a family photo with pets and keep the dog close to the family. Make the scene calm, natural, and family-first.
Anime keepsake idea
Turn this family photo idea into an anime keepsake with soft color, clear faces, and gentle expressions.

Idea formula

Family photo idea + scene + style + one must-have.

Example: "Create a warm family photo idea with golden hour light, relaxed smiles, and simple outdoor framing."
